Obter informações do sistema a partir da linha de comando no Mac OS X

Índice:

Anonim

Independentemente de quantos Macs você administra, certamente chegará um momento em que você precisará recuperar informações relevantes do sistema. Isso pode ser feito a partir da interface gráfica com o utilitário Apple System Profiler, mas muitas vezes você também precisará extrair detalhes do sistema do terminal.

A coleta de informações do sistema a partir da linha de comando é vital para a administração do sistema e da rede, portanto, da próxima vez que você acessar uma máquina por meio do SSH, certamente descobrirá o que precisa saber com dois comandos úteis ferramentas de linha.Você pode obter quase todos os detalhes do sistema imagináveis ​​com esses utilitários poderosos, cada um é um pouco diferente, então veja como, usando o comando sw_vers e o comando system_profiler:

Como obter a versão do sistema Mac OS X com sw_vers

O comando sw_vers é curto e agradável, ele fornecerá a versão atual do sistema operacional Mac e o número de compilação do Mac OS X, com uso e saída como tal:

$ sw_vers ProductName: Mac OS X ProductVersion: 10.4.9 BuildVersion: 8P2137

Como obter detalhes do sistema Mac com system_profiler

system_profiler é apenas uma interface de linha de comando para o aplicativo Mac GUI System Profiler (encontrado na pasta Utilitários do Mac OS X). É muito útil para aprender sobre uma máquina em uma rede ou conexão remota via SSH. A saída padrão irá explodir você com tela cheia de conteúdo, então é melhor passar pelo comando more da seguinte forma:

$ system_profiler | mais

Isso permitirá que você visualize a saída de system_profiler uma tela por vez, navegável pelas teclas de seta e página para cima/para baixo.

A ferramenta system_profiler geralmente é melhor usada em conjunto com grep para que você possa encontrar informações específicas, seja a placa de vídeo usada em um Mac, tipo de monitor, número de série, velocidade de um Mac, total memória instalada, o fabricante de um disco rígido ou qualquer outra coisa.

Encontrando detalhes do sistema com uname

Outra opção é o útil comando uname, melhor usado com -a sinalizador:

uname -a

A saída disso inclui a versão do kernel darwin do Mac OS X, data, versão xnu, se o Mac é de 64 bits (todos são, se forem novos), etc.:

$ uname -a Darwin Retina-MacBook-Pro.local 15.3.0 Darwin Kernel Versão 15.3.0: Mon Dec 23 11:59:05 PDT 2015; root:xnu-2782.20.48~5/RELEASE_X86_64 x86_64

Use a ferramenta necessária para o trabalho, todas são extremamente úteis.

Se você está procurando informações sobre sua conexão com o aeroporto, certifique-se de usar o utilitário oculto do aeroporto discutido aqui.

Obter informações do sistema a partir da linha de comando no Mac OS X